You could just do a sickeningly long workout, like many pro bodybuilders did back in the day. 3 times a week for 4h still adds up. Anyways, you don’t need to spend that much time even at intermediate levels and beyond if you do enough compounds (not just bench, squat and diddly, but also weighted chin ups, weighted dips, barbell rows etc). Can get done in 90 mins and still get your 20 weekly sets per muscle group. Will be a tough workout though, definitely not doable when cutting

Well it's not because you're doing a full body but splitting the total volume that you would do on one day in a split over multiple days instead.
Program doesn't matter if you don't know the total volume and frequency you're lifting.

A full body can hit the same muscle 3x a week, according to this study it would mean in theory that to split the volume of a pplxppl even further would give you even better results for muscle size.
Full body doesn't mean doing SL 5x5 only. You can do it more frequently, split stuff up into morning and evening.
